Travel 200 years back in time for Independence Day weekend at Fort Atkinson State Historical Park! Visitors will be able to glimpse the holiday activities that would have taken place at this 1820s era outpost.Ongoing demonstrations featuring military and civilian life of the 1820s will occur throughout the park. Reenactors portray fur traders, coopers, blacksmiths, carpenters, tinsmiths, weavers and other period trades. Visitors are encouraged to interact with the reenactors.
